In Re Leslie N. Wilder, James C. Whitney and Gary G. Matison, and Lanier Business Products, Intervenor

How courts have described this case

Verbatim parenthetical descriptions written by other courts when citing this decision. Ranked by citation-network relevance.

  • “adding dependent claims as a hedge against possible invalidity of original claims is a proper reason for asking that a reissue be granted”
  • broadly worded title, general description of drawing, and objects of invention of parent patent application did not adequately support reissue application claims directed to genus of indicating mechanisms for dictating machines
